Action from start to finish on today's trip.

With the conditions the same as yesterday, we decided to fish down the beach again. Glad we did as the wind didn't blow as hard as yesterday but still would have not produced half of what we caught today, fishing In the Bay.

Very good short action with some nice keepers mixed in through-out the day. Many customers had 2 nice fish for dinner along with a bunch of shorts. High Hook guys had 3 in the cooler.  Couple 3- 5 pound fish in the mix with the pool fish making just under 6 pounds.

Current ran hard to the North and you needed the weight to hold, even tight to the beach. Buck tail guys did much better  and the bait worked well also. Naturally when we got to the dock there was hardly a Breeze!!
